How to Speak Effectively as a CEO
As a CEO, speaking effectively is crucial to inspire confidence and lead an organization successfully. Communication is not just about delivering a message; it’s about delivering that message in a way that resonates with your audience. A CEO’s ability to convey ideas clearly and persuasively can be the difference between success and failure. In today’s fast-paced world, even small nuances in communication can significantly impact how ideas are perceived.
An essential aspect of effective communication is understanding your audience. Each audience has unique needs, expectations, and levels of understanding. Tailoring your message to fit these aspects ensures that your communication is relevant and impactful. It’s not just about what you’re saying, but how you say it and the timing of your delivery.
Moreover, mastering the art of public speaking can greatly enhance a CEO’s ability to lead. By focusing on aspects such as voice modulation, body language, and engagement strategies, a CEO can transform the way they connect with both internal teams and external stakeholders. Developing a strong personal brand is also integral for CEOs. This involves creating a consistent narrative that aligns with both their personal values and the company’s mission. A coherent personal brand can make a CEO’s message feel more authentic and relatable. Authenticity in communication bridges the gap between a CEO and their audience, fostering trust and loyalty.
Finally, understanding how to speak effectively requires continuous learning and adaptation. The methods that worked a decade ago may not necessarily be applicable in today’s context. Hence, CEOs should be open to acquiring new skills and techniques to stay relevant in the ever-evolving corporate landscape.
